Transaction 454e4095a6576efb0f907b190621d3be149dd0a95bb2686646bd2948ab91a43c
1 Input
1 Output
-
454e4095a6576efb0f907b190621d3be149dd0a95bb2686646bd2948ab91a43c:0
- value
- 20988891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9f4aa31f2a5f85c4ea3f27d6a20d5f7a6dfbea5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NL3YJnA8oxaREErniTnEcYHEkvd4R1E9L